根据示例编写一份代码
这里是一个示例代码,可以帮助你开始编写你的代码:
def calculate_average(numbers):
total = sum(numbers)
average = total / len(numbers)
return average
def main():
# 提示用户输入数字,直到输入完成
numbers = []
while True:
value = input("请输入一个数字(输入q退出):")
if value == 'q':
break
try:
number = float(value)
numbers.append(number)
except ValueError:
print("输入无效,请输入一个数字或者输入q退出。")
# 计算平均值并输出
average = calculate_average(numbers)
print("平均值为:", average)
if __name__ == "__main__":
main()
这个示例代码实现了以下功能:
- 提示用户输入数字,直到用户输入"q"为止。
- 将用户输入的数字存储在一个列表中。
- 调用
calculate_average函数计算列表中数字的平均值。 - 输出平均值。
你可以根据自己的需求修改这段代码
原文地址: https://www.cveoy.top/t/topic/iRLe 著作权归作者所有。请勿转载和采集!